Removal And Installation

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2019 RAM 3500 HD and 2019 RAM 2500 HD.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.

REMOVAL 

  1. Disconnect and isolate the negative battery cable(s). Refer to STANDARD PROCEDURE .
  2. Remove the Exhaust Gas Recirculation (EGR) crossover tube. Refer to TUBE, EXHAUST GAS RECIRCULATION (EGR), RE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ION .
    GC0169678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  3. Remove the nut (1), bolt (3) and the EGR Airflow control valve shield (2).
    GC0155380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  4. Loosen the clamps (1) and remove the Charge Air Cooler (CAC) hose (3) from the EGR air flow control valve.
  5. Disconnect the EGR air flow control valve wire harness connector (2).
    GC0184831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  6. Disconnect the Temperature and Manifold Absolute Pressure (TMAP) sensor wire harness connector (3).
    GC0185293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  7. Disconnect the EGR valve wire harness connector (1).
    GC0185808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  8. Remove the bolt (3) securing oil dipstick tube (4).
  9. Remove the bolts and the oil dipstick tube bracket (2).
    GC0184884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  10. Remove the bolts (3) and the intake manifold (2).
  11. Remove and discard the gasket (1).
    GC0185637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  12. If necessary, remove the bolts (1) and the EGR valve (2).

INSTALLATION 

  1. Clean all gasket mating surfaces.
    GC0185637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  2. If removed, using a NEW  gasket, install the EGR valve (2) and tighten the bolts (1) to the proper specification. Refer to T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S .
    GC0184884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
    NOTE:

    The gasket (1) must be installed with part number facing up and tab oriented towards the front of the engine.

  3. Using a NEW  gasket (1), install the intake manifold (2) and tighten the bolts (3) to the proper specification. Refer to T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S .
    GC0185808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  4. Install the oil dipstick tube bracket (2) and tighten the bolts (1) to proper specification. Refer to T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S .
  5. Install the bolt (3) securing the oil dip stick tube (4) to the bracket and tighten to proper specification. Refer to T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S .
    GC0185293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  6. Connect the EGR valve wire harness connector (1).
    GC0184831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  7. Connect the TMAP sensor wire harness connector (3).
    GC0155380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  8. Connect EGR air flow control valve wire harness connector (2).
  9. Install the Charge Air Cooler (CAC) hose (3) to the EGR air flow control valve and tighten the clamp (1) to the proper specification. Refer to T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S .
    GC0169678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  10. Install the EGR airflow control valve shield (2) and tighten the bolt (3) and nut (1) to the proper specification. Refer to T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S .
  11. Install the EGR crossover tube. Refer to TUBE, EXHAUST GAS RECIRCULATION (EGR), RE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ION .
  12. Connect the negative battery cable(s). Refer to STANDARD PROCEDURE .
